What is a Miter Saw?
At its core, a miter saw is a power tool utilized for making precise crosscuts and miters in a workpiece. The blade is installed on a swing arm that pivots left or best to produce angled cuts. These cuts end up being essential when dealing with trim work, framing, and other woodworking jobs that require precision.

When selecting a miter saw, it's important to think about the features that will best suit your requirements. Here's a list of common functions to look for:
Blade Size: Typically ranges from 8 to 12 inches. Bigger blades can cut thicker products.
Laser Guide: Projects a cutting line on the workpiece for higher precision.
Dust Collection System: Helps keep a clean work space by gathering debris developed during cuts.
Rotating Arm: Allows the saw head to move efficiently and slice at numerous angles.
Bevel Capabilities: Many miter saws can produce both miter and bevel cuts.
Table Extensions: Useful for supporting bigger workpieces, improving the tool's stability.
Safety Features: Blade guards and electric brakes to boost user safety.

How to Maintain Your Miter Saw
Appropriate maintenance will prolong the life of your miter saw and boost its efficiency. Here are upkeep pointers:
Keep the Blade Sharp: Dull blades can lead to imprecise cuts and increased pressure on the motor.
Regular Cleaning: Remove sawdust and particles from the motor and the blade after every use.
Check for Loose Parts: Periodically inspect screws and bolts; tighten them as essential.
Lube: Keep moving parts lubed for smooth operation.
Check Electrical Components: Regularly examine cords and plugs for any signs of wear or damage.
Frequently Asked Question About Miter SawsQ1: What is the distinction in between a miter saw and a circular saw?
A: Miter saws are created for precise crosscuts and angles, while circular saws are flexible tools that can make straight cuts in different materials.
Q2: How do I choose the ideal miter saw for my tasks?
A: Assess the kinds of cuts you will make, the products you will deal with, and whether you require extra functions like bevel abilities or sliding movement.
Q3: Can I utilize a miter saw to cut metal or plastic?
A: Standard miter saws are not perfect for cutting metal. Utilize a blade specifically designed for metal or a different kind of saw, like a band saw, for that function.
Q4: What safety preventative measures should I take while using a miter saw?
A: Always use eye defense, keep hands clear of the blade, make sure the saw is steady, and never ever start the saw while the blade is versus the product.
Q5: How frequently should the blade be changed?
A: Change the blade when you see a decrease in cutting performance or if you see damage or excessive wear.
